aboutsummaryrefslogtreecommitdiff
path: root/par/qc0-mclachlan.par
diff options
context:
space:
mode:
authorErik Schnetter <schnetter@cct.lsu.edu>2009-12-27 23:56:35 +0100
committerErik Schnetter <schnetter@cct.lsu.edu>2009-12-27 23:57:41 +0100
commitbf34a0ebe6720a208ca3450d140a35d0f7b0997d (patch)
treea06dd75ce7a79ef209a68676c70aef3983a5537b /par/qc0-mclachlan.par
parent1c024ea6174041cc6a22cd6ba478b0135b4dff01 (diff)
Update example parameter files:
- remove outdated examples - ensure the vacuum example works - add matter example
Diffstat (limited to 'par/qc0-mclachlan.par')
-rw-r--r--par/qc0-mclachlan.par297
1 files changed, 73 insertions, 224 deletions
diff --git a/par/qc0-mclachlan.par b/par/qc0-mclachlan.par
index 5ccdaed..ca2d880 100644
--- a/par/qc0-mclachlan.par
+++ b/par/qc0-mclachlan.par
@@ -4,8 +4,6 @@ Cactus::cctk_full_warnings = yes
Cactus::highlight_warning_messages = no
Cactus::terminate = "time"
-#Cactus::cctk_final_time = 1.0
-#Cactus::cctk_final_time = 10.0
Cactus::cctk_final_time = 100.0
@@ -16,32 +14,19 @@ IO::out_dir = $parfile
-ActiveThorns = "ManualTermination"
-
-ManualTermination::max_walltime = @WALLTIME_HOURS@ # hours
-ManualTermination::on_remaining_walltime = 60 # minutes
-
-ManualTermination::termination_from_file = yes
-ManualTermination::create_termination_file = yes
-ManualTermination::termination_file = "../TERMINATE"
-
-
-
ActiveThorns = "AEILocalInterp"
ActiveThorns = "BLAS LAPACK"
ActiveThorns = "Fortran"
-ActiveThorns = "LocalInterp"
-
ActiveThorns = "GenericFD"
ActiveThorns = "HDF5"
-ActiveThorns = "LoopControl"
+ActiveThorns = "LocalInterp"
-#ActiveThorns = "NaNCatcher"
+ActiveThorns = "LoopControl"
ActiveThorns = "Slab"
@@ -64,8 +49,10 @@ ActiveThorns = "InitBase"
ActiveThorns = "Carpet CarpetLib CarpetInterp CarpetReduce CarpetSlab"
Carpet::verbose = no
-Carpet::schedule_barriers = no
Carpet::veryverbose = no
+Carpet::schedule_barriers = no
+Carpet::storage_verbose = no
+Carpet::timers_verbose = no
CarpetLib::output_bboxes = no
Carpet::domain_from_coordbase = yes
@@ -79,29 +66,39 @@ Carpet::prolongation_order_time = 2
Carpet::convergence_level = 0
-Carpet::init_3_timelevels = yes
+Carpet::init_fill_timelevels = yes
Carpet::poison_new_timelevels = yes
CarpetLib::poison_new_memory = yes
-Carpet::output_timers_every = 512
-CarpetLib::print_timestats_every = 512
-CarpetLib::print_memstats_every = 512
+Carpet::output_timers_every = 5120
+CarpetLib::print_timestats_every = 5120
+CarpetLib::print_memstats_every = 5120
ActiveThorns = "NaNChecker"
-NaNChecker::check_every = 512
-NaNChecker::action_if_found = "just warn"
+NaNChecker::check_every = 1 # 512
+#NaNChecker::verbose = "all"
+#NaNChecker::action_if_found = "just warn"
+NaNChecker::action_if_found = "terminate"
NaNChecker::check_vars = "
- ML_BSSN::ML_Gamma
- ML_BSSN::ML_lapse
- ML_BSSN::ML_shift
- ML_BSSN::ML_log_confac
- ML_BSSN::ML_metric
- ML_BSSN::ML_trace_curv
- ML_BSSN::ML_curv
+ ML_BSSN::ML_log_confac
+ ML_BSSN::ML_metric
+ ML_BSSN::ML_trace_curv
+ ML_BSSN::ML_curv
+ ML_BSSN::ML_Gamma
+ ML_BSSN::ML_lapse
+ ML_BSSN::ML_shift
+ ML_BSSN::ML_dtlapse
+ ML_BSSN::ML_dtshift
+ ADMBase::metric
+ ADMBase::curv
+ ADMBase::lapse
+ ADMBase::shift
+ ADMBase::dtlapse
+ ADMBase::dtshift
"
@@ -177,7 +174,7 @@ SphericalSurface::nghostsphi [5] = 2
ActiveThorns = "CarpetMask"
-CarpetMask::verbose = yes
+CarpetMask::verbose = no
CarpetMask::excluded_surface [0] = 0
CarpetMask::excluded_surface_factor[0] = 1.0
@@ -196,9 +193,10 @@ CarpetTracker::surface[0] = 0
CarpetTracker::surface[1] = 1
CarpetTracker::surface[2] = 2
-CarpetRegrid2::regrid_every = 128
-
-CarpetRegrid2::symmetry_rotating180 = yes
+CarpetRegrid2::regrid_every = 128
+CarpetRegrid2::freeze_unaligned_levels = yes
+CarpetRegrid2::symmetry_rotating180 = yes
+CarpetRegrid2::verbose = yes
CarpetRegrid2::num_centres = 3
@@ -240,7 +238,9 @@ MoL::ODE_Method = "RK4"
MoL::MoL_Intermediate_Steps = 4
MoL::MoL_Num_Scratch_Levels = 1
-Time::dtfac = 0.40
+Carpet::time_refinement_factors = "[1, 1, 2, 4, 8, 16, 32, 64, 128, 256]"
+
+Time::dtfac = 0.25
@@ -268,7 +268,6 @@ TwoPunctures::par_P_minus[1] = -0.3331917498
#TODO# TwoPunctures::grid_setup_method = "evaluation"
-#TwoPunctures::TP_epsilon = 1.0e-4
TwoPunctures::TP_epsilon = 1.0e-2
TwoPunctures::TP_Tiny = 1.0e-2
@@ -276,11 +275,13 @@ TwoPunctures::verbose = yes
-ActiveThorns = "ML_BSSN ML_BSSN_Helper"
+ActiveThorns = "ML_BSSN ML_BSSN_Helper NewRad"
-ADMBase::evolution_method = "ML_BSSN"
-ADMBase::lapse_evolution_method = "ML_BSSN"
-ADMBase::shift_evolution_method = "ML_BSSN"
+ADMBase::evolution_method = "ML_BSSN"
+ADMBase::lapse_evolution_method = "ML_BSSN"
+ADMBase::shift_evolution_method = "ML_BSSN"
+ADMBase::dtlapse_evolution_method = "ML_BSSN"
+ADMBase::dtshift_evolution_method = "ML_BSSN"
ML_BSSN::harmonicN = 1 # 1+log
ML_BSSN::harmonicF = 2.0 # 1+log
@@ -289,17 +290,11 @@ ML_BSSN::BetaDriver = 1.0
ML_BSSN::LapseAdvectionCoeff = 1.0
ML_BSSN::ShiftAdvectionCoeff = 1.0
-#ML_BSSN::ML_log_confac_bound = "radiative"
-#ML_BSSN::ML_metric_bound = "radiative"
-#ML_BSSN::ML_Gamma_bound = "radiative"
-#ML_BSSN::ML_trace_curv_bound = "radiative"
-#ML_BSSN::ML_curv_bound = "radiative"
-#ML_BSSN::ML_lapse_bound = "radiative"
-#ML_BSSN::ML_dtlapse_bound = "radiative"
-#ML_BSSN::ML_shift_bound = "radiative"
-#ML_BSSN::ML_dtshift_bound = "radiative"
+ML_BSSN::MinimumLapse = 1.0e-8
-ML_BSSN::my_boundary_condition = "Minkowski"
+ML_BSSN::my_initial_boundary_condition = "extrapolate-gammas"
+ML_BSSN::my_rhs_boundary_condition = "NewRad"
+Boundary::radpower = 2
ML_BSSN::ML_log_confac_bound = "none"
ML_BSSN::ML_metric_bound = "none"
@@ -317,13 +312,15 @@ ActiveThorns = "Dissipation"
Dissipation::order = 5
Dissipation::vars = "
- ML_BSSN::ML_Gamma
- ML_BSSN::ML_lapse
- ML_BSSN::ML_shift
- ML_BSSN::ML_log_confac
- ML_BSSN::ML_metric
- ML_BSSN::ML_trace_curv
- ML_BSSN::ML_curv
+ ML_BSSN::ML_log_confac
+ ML_BSSN::ML_metric
+ ML_BSSN::ML_trace_curv
+ ML_BSSN::ML_curv
+ ML_BSSN::ML_Gamma
+ ML_BSSN::ML_lapse
+ ML_BSSN::ML_shift
+ ML_BSSN::ML_dtlapse
+ ML_BSSN::ML_dtshift
"
@@ -394,116 +391,13 @@ AHFinderDirect::find_after_individual_time [6] = 15.0
-ActiveThorns = "IsolatedHorizon"
-
-IsolatedHorizon::verbose = yes
-IsolatedHorizon::interpolator = "Lagrange polynomial interpolation"
-IsolatedHorizon::interpolator_options = "order=4"
-IsolatedHorizon::spatial_order = 6
-
-IsolatedHorizon::num_horizons = 6
-
-IsolatedHorizon::surface_index [0] = 0
-IsolatedHorizon::companion_index[0] = 4
-
-IsolatedHorizon::surface_index [1] = 1
-
-IsolatedHorizon::surface_index [2] = 2
-
-IsolatedHorizon::surface_index [3] = 3
-IsolatedHorizon::companion_index[3] = 5
-
-IsolatedHorizon::surface_index [4] = 4
-
-IsolatedHorizon::surface_index [5] = 5
-
-
-
-ActiveThorns = "ProperDistance ProperTime"
-
-ProperDistance::number_geodesics = 512
-ProperDistance::direction = "x"
-ProperDistance::plane = "xy"
-ProperDistance::opening_angle = 180.0
-ProperDistance::step_size = 0.04
-ProperDistance::horizon_number = 1
-ProperDistance::interpolation_order = 3
-ProperDistance::integration_method = "rk4"
-ProperDistance::eps = 0.00001
-ProperDistance::max_proper_distance = 15
-ProperDistance::calc_every = 128
-ProperDistance::use_second_horizon = yes
-ProperDistance::second_horizon_number = 2
-
-
-
-ActiveThorns = "PsiKadelia"
-
-PsiKadelia::psikadelia_persists = yes
-PsiKadelia::calc_every = 256 # only on levels 0 and 1
-PsiKadelia::ricci_prolongation_type = "none"
-PsiKadelia::weyl_timelevels = 3
-PsiKadelia::psif_vec = "standard-radial"
-
-
-
-ActiveThorns = "ModeDecomposition"
-
-ModeDecomposition::lmax = 8
-ModeDecomposition::ntheta = 35
-ModeDecomposition::nphi = 72
-
-ModeDecomposition::num_vars = 5
-ModeDecomposition::variable_re[0] = "PsiKadelia::psi0re"
-ModeDecomposition::variable_im[0] = "PsiKadelia::psi0im"
-ModeDecomposition::spin_weight[0] = +2
-ModeDecomposition::variable_re[1] = "PsiKadelia::psi1re"
-ModeDecomposition::variable_im[1] = "PsiKadelia::psi1im"
-ModeDecomposition::spin_weight[1] = +1
-ModeDecomposition::variable_re[2] = "PsiKadelia::psi2re"
-ModeDecomposition::variable_im[2] = "PsiKadelia::psi2im"
-ModeDecomposition::spin_weight[2] = 0
-ModeDecomposition::variable_re[3] = "PsiKadelia::psi3re"
-ModeDecomposition::variable_im[3] = "PsiKadelia::psi3im"
-ModeDecomposition::spin_weight[3] = -1
-ModeDecomposition::variable_re[4] = "PsiKadelia::psi4re"
-ModeDecomposition::variable_im[4] = "PsiKadelia::psi4im"
-ModeDecomposition::spin_weight[4] = -2
-
-ModeDecomposition::num_radii = 5
-ModeDecomposition::radius[0] = 30
-ModeDecomposition::radius[1] = 40
-ModeDecomposition::radius[2] = 50
-ModeDecomposition::radius[3] = 60
-ModeDecomposition::radius[4] = 70
-
-
-
-ActiveThorns = "WaveExtract"
-
-WaveExtract::out_every = 128
-WaveExtract::maximum_detector_number = 5
-WaveExtract::switch_output_format = 100
-WaveExtract::rsch2_computation = "average Schwarzschild metric"
-WaveExtract::l_mode = 8
-WaveExtract::m_mode = 8
-WaveExtract::detector_radius[0] = 30
-WaveExtract::detector_radius[1] = 40
-WaveExtract::detector_radius[2] = 50
-WaveExtract::detector_radius[3] = 60
-WaveExtract::detector_radius[4] = 70
-
-
-
ActiveThorns = "CarpetIOBasic"
IOBasic::outInfo_every = 128
IOBasic::outInfo_reductions = "norm2"
IOBasic::outInfo_vars = "
- Carpet::timing
+ Carpet::physical_time_per_hour
ADMConstraints::ham
- IsolatedHorizon::ih_spin[0]
- IsolatedHorizon::ih_radius[0]
"
@@ -524,21 +418,6 @@ IOScalar::outScalar_vars = "
ADMConstraints::hamiltonian
ADMConstraints::momentum
SphericalSurface::sf_radius
- IsolatedHorizon::ih_shapes
- IsolatedHorizon::ih_coordinates
- IsolatedHorizon::ih_tetrad_l
- IsolatedHorizon::ih_tetrad_n
- IsolatedHorizon::ih_tetrad_m
- IsolatedHorizon::ih_newman_penrose
- IsolatedHorizon::ih_weyl_scalars
- IsolatedHorizon::ih_twometric
- IsolatedHorizon::ih_killing_vector
- IsolatedHorizon::ih_killed_twometric
- IsolatedHorizon::ih_invariant_coordinates
- IsolatedHorizon::ih_multipole_moments
- IsolatedHorizon::ih_3determinant
- PsiKadelia::WeylComponents
- ModeDecomposition::modes
"
@@ -568,28 +447,6 @@ IOASCII::out0D_vars = "
SphericalSurface::sf_radius
SphericalSurface::sf_origin
SphericalSurface::sf_coordinate_descriptors
- IsolatedHorizon::ih_shapes
- IsolatedHorizon::ih_state
- IsolatedHorizon::ih_grid_int
- IsolatedHorizon::ih_grid_real
- IsolatedHorizon::ih_shapes
- IsolatedHorizon::ih_coordinates
- IsolatedHorizon::ih_tetrad_l
- IsolatedHorizon::ih_tetrad_n
- IsolatedHorizon::ih_tetrad_m
- IsolatedHorizon::ih_newman_penrose
- IsolatedHorizon::ih_weyl_scalars
- IsolatedHorizon::ih_twometric
- IsolatedHorizon::ih_killing_vector
- IsolatedHorizon::ih_killed_twometric
- IsolatedHorizon::ih_scalars
- IsolatedHorizon::ih_invariant_coordinates
- IsolatedHorizon::ih_multipole_moments
- IsolatedHorizon::ih_3determinant
- PsiKadelia::WeylComponents
- ModeDecomposition::modes
- ProperDistance::pdistance
- ProperTime::ptime
"
IOASCII::out1D_every = 128
@@ -604,29 +461,24 @@ IOASCII::out1D_vars = "
ADMConstraints::hamiltonian
ADMConstraints::momentum
SphericalSurface::sf_radius
- IsolatedHorizon::ih_shapes
- IsolatedHorizon::ih_weyl_scalars
- IsolatedHorizon::ih_killing_vector
- IsolatedHorizon::ih_killed_twometric
- IsolatedHorizon::ih_3determinant
- PsiKadelia::WeylComponents
- ModeDecomposition::modes
"
IOASCII::out2D_every = 128
IOASCII::out2D_vars = "
SphericalSurface::sf_radius
- PsiKadelia::WeylComponents
"
Activethorns = "CarpetIOHDF5"
-IOHDF5::out_every = 512
-IOHDF5::one_file_per_group = yes
-IOHDF5::compression_level = 1
-IOHDF5::out_vars = "
+IOHDF5::out_every = 512
+IOHDF5::one_file_per_group = yes
+IOHDF5::output_symmetry_points = no
+IOHDF5::out3D_ghosts = no
+IOHDF5::compression_level = 1
+IOHDF5::use_checksums = yes
+IOHDF5::out_vars = "
CarpetReduce::weight
ADMBase::metric
ADMBase::curv
@@ -636,14 +488,13 @@ IOHDF5::out_vars = "
ADMBase::dtshift
ADMConstraints::hamiltonian
ADMConstraints::momentum
- PsiKadelia::WeylComponents
"
-IOHDF5::checkpoint = yes
-IO::checkpoint_dir = $parfile
-IO::checkpoint_ID = yes
-IO::checkpoint_every = 512
-IO::checkpoint_on_terminate = yes
+IOHDF5::checkpoint = yes
+IO::checkpoint_dir = $parfile
+IO::checkpoint_ID = yes
+IO::checkpoint_every_walltime_hours = 6.0
+IO::checkpoint_on_terminate = yes
IO::recover = "autoprobe"
IO::recover_dir = $parfile
@@ -652,14 +503,12 @@ IO::recover_dir = $parfile
ActiveThorns = "Formaline"
-#Formaline::publish_level = 2
-#Formaline::send_as_rdf = yes
-#Formaline::rdf_hostname[0] = "buran.aei.mpg.de"
-#Formaline::rdf_port [0] = 24997
-
ActiveThorns = "TimerReport"
-TimerReport::out_every = 512
-TimerReport::out_filename = "TimerReport"
+TimerReport::out_every = 5120
+TimerReport::out_filename = "TimerReport"
+TimerReport::output_all_timers_together = yes
+TimerReport::output_all_timers_readable = yes
+TimerReport::n_top_timers = 20